Death toll rises to 37 in Russian apartment block blastMOSCOW (AFP) - The number of confirmed dead from a New Year's Eve gas explosion that caused a Russian apartment block to partially collapse has risen to 37, officials said on Thursday (Jan 3), with four people still missing..
